About This Novel

In the seventh year of the great cause, the huge Sui Empire was blooming with flowers and burning with fire. Trapped deep in the palace, the evil dragon Yang Guang, who is above the Ninth Five-Year Plan, is planning a grand blueprint of surpassing the three emperors in skill and surpassing the five emperors in virtue. Little did he know that the entire world was about to collapse at his command. A song of hopeless wandering in Liaodong marked the beginning of troubled times. Pei Sheng, an unknown boy, came through time travel and took the name of a descendant of the Pei family in Hedong. He was already in jail before he could take a look at the world. Some people want him dead: the Guanlong family, the Hanmen of Hebei, and the gentry of Jiangnan, all the forces are competing with each other. Some people want him to live: thirty-six roads to rebel against the king, seventy-two roads to smoke, and all the rebels from all over the world come to rob the prisoner. Conquer Goguryeo, occupy Hebei, seize Shandong, enter the Yangtze River and Huaihe River, and enter Guanzhong. He captured Dou Jiande, Dou Wang Shichong, defeated Du Fuwei, and destroyed Liang Shidu Liu Wuzhou. Finally, he competed with Li Shimin for the world. In this chess game: he wants to change from a chess piece to a chess player! He wants to make Wagang a burner of incense no longer inferior to the three sworn brothers in Taoyuan! He wants to create a more glorious and prosperous age than Zhenguan! If the evil dragon brings trouble to the world, then I will kill the dragon! If this country is empty, then I will ask the sun and moon to replace the sky with a new one!
